Someone please help me w this standard form question​
svp [43]

Answer:

2.4 × 10⁶

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

  • \sf x=3.8 \times 10^5
  • \sf y=5.9 \times 10^4

To calculate the value of R, substitute the given values into the given formula:

\begin{aligned}\sf R & = \sf \dfrac{x^2}{y}\\\\ \implies \sf R& = \sf \dfrac{(3.8 \times 10^5)^2}{5.9 \times 10^4}\\\\& = \sf \dfrac{3.8^2 \times (10^5)^2}{5.9 \times 10^4}\\\\& = \sf \dfrac{14.44 \times 10^{10}}{5.9 \times 10^4}\\\\& = \sf \dfrac{14.44}{5.9} \times \dfrac{10^{10}}{10^4}\\\\& = \sf 2.4474... \times 10^{(10-4)}\\\\& = \sf 2.4474... \times 10^6\\\\\end{aligned}

Therefore, the value of R to 1 decimal place is 2.4 × 10⁶
